📖 Bible References
Matthew 4:17: From that time on Jesus began to preach, 'Repent, for the kingdom of heaven has come near.' Luke 15:18-19: I have sinned against heaven and against you and am no longer worthy to be called your son; make me like one of your hired servants. Acts 26:20: First to the people of Damascus, then to the people of Jerusalem and all Judea, and to the Gentiles, I preached that they should repent and turn to God and prove their repentance by their deeds. 2 Corinthians 7:10: Godly sorrow brings repentance that leads to salvation and leaves no regret, but worldly sorrow produces death. Isaiah 55:7: Let the wicked forsake their ways and the unrighteous their thoughts. Let them turn to the Lord, and he will have compassion on them, and to our God, for he will freely pardon.
